PSV Eindhoven midfielder Gaston Pereiro said his agent is talking to Aston Villa about a January move on radio station Sport 890.
The 24-year-old Uruguay international said that his club have come to an agreement with MLS franchise Cincinnati, but he would prefer to stay in Europe.
He said his agent is working on an offer from Villa, as Dean Smith embarks on further reinforcements this month to boost his squad’s chances of beating the drop.
Pereiro said: “PSV told me that they have already come to an agreement with Cincinnati. I told my representative that if there is a chance to stay in Europe I prefer that. He is working on an offer from Aston Villa.”

Pereiro had a decent 2018/19, scoring 11 goals across all competitions (Transfermarkt) but has played just 345 minutes for PSV this term.
Many Villa fans on Twitter had not heard of the midfielder before, and some questioned his suitability to come in and hit the ground running considering he has been out of the fold at PSV.
But there was some excitement about the prospect of signing a 24-year-old international playmaker with a good record in previous seasons and adding him to a squad which relies too much on Jack Grealish for creativity.
